Lower Moreland, PA is an affluent suburb of Philadelphia, and its housing market reflects this. The median value for houses in Lower Moreland is more than double the US national average, amounting to $569,400. Furthermore, the 1 year home appreciation rate in Lower Moreland is 11.01%, significantly higher than the US national average of 8.27%. This makes Lower Moreland an attractive option for potential homeowners looking to purchase a house with potential for high returns on their investment.

The median home cost in Lower Moreland is $569,400. Home appreciation the last 10 years has been 64.0%. Home Appreciation in Lower Moreland is up 12.4%.
